First appearance of the new Denton "Central" Police Station, which is used until the end of the series. The previous building in Leeds was sold and soon demolished. Interestingly, the first novel, "Frost at Christmas", refers to a new station being planned for Denton, but this never eventuates.
This episode is based on one-half of the recently released Frost novel "Hard Frost", the first written in five years.
First and only appearance of D.C. Burton, who was a prominent character in the Frost novels up to this point, making his debut in the second, "A Touch of Frost", as a P.C., who by the next novel "Night Frost" has transferred to C.I.D. The original series character of D.C. Mark Howard was based on him.
Final appearance of the Ford Sierra ("D843 MPP") that had been Frost's car since the start of the series.
The only episode when Frost is shown reading a national newspaper, as opposed to the (fictional) "Denton Evening News". It's near the end, as Frost is sitting on a park bench waiting to accost his suspect and his choice is "the guardian".
